In the article on Home Depot adding Spanish language signs, this professor at NYU, Marcelo Suárez- Orozco, is quoted as saying that Hispanics will add $1 trillion to the nation's economy by the end of the decade.

Assuming 50 million Hispanics in 2010 (the figure given is 37.5 million today), then that means a contribution of $200,000 per person. Since the U.S. per capita income is $40,000, it just seems like a preposterous figure that this professor is floating.
